graviz wrote:

Just wondering what kind of trailer tires you have and why or why not?


OEM tires = Goodyear "Marathon" S/T = 235/80R16 = 6 ply = 3000# @ 65PSI = load Range "D"

Present Tires = Powerking "Towmax" S/T = 235/80R16 = 10 ply = 3500$ @ 80 PSI = Load Range "E"

Goodyears were worn out and failing by 25K miles. I'd never have another set of them again!!!....................

Michelin XPS Ribs

Bought them a year ago from Discount Tire for $758.

We've put 17,000 miles on them so far--a trip to Arizona and one to Alaska. Very happy with them--haven't even had to add any more air. Paid Discount Tire $758 for set of 4.

Also added a SmarTire pressure and temperature monitoring system when the new tires were mounted. I'm very happy with this system; its temperature monitoring tipped me off to a brake problem before there was any damage--caliper on one wheel wasn't fully releasing.
